Core Responsibilities of a Director at PT Agres Info Teknologi
Alright, let's break down the core responsibilities of a director at PT Agres Info Teknologi. It's all about strategic direction, operational oversight, and ensuring the company is hitting its goals. Firstly, a director is responsible for strategic planning. This means setting the long-term vision and goals of the company. They need to understand the market, identify opportunities, and make sure the company is prepared for future challenges. This involves market analysis, competitor analysis, and, ultimately, defining the company's mission and how it will achieve it. Strategic planning is crucial to success; without a clear direction, a company can easily get lost in the shuffle. It's the director's job to chart the course, ensuring everyone is working toward the same objectives. Then there is financial oversight. Directors are accountable for the financial health of the company. They review financial statements, approve budgets, and make decisions about investments. This involves a deep understanding of financial principles and the ability to manage risk effectively. Financial stability is the backbone of any successful company, and it's the director's responsibility to ensure that the company remains solvent and profitable. Next up, is operational management. Directors oversee the day-to-day operations of the company, ensuring that everything runs smoothly. This includes making decisions about staffing, resource allocation, and project management. Operational management is all about efficiency and effectiveness. Directors have to be able to identify and resolve problems quickly, making sure that projects are delivered on time and within budget. This requires strong organizational skills and the ability to coordinate different teams and departments. Last but not least, is leadership and team management. Directors are leaders who must inspire and motivate their team. They must foster a positive work environment, make sure everyone is aligned with the company's goals, and build a culture of collaboration and innovation. Team management is critical to success. A director must be able to recognize talent, delegate responsibilities effectively, and provide mentorship and guidance to their team members. It is all about how directors shape the culture of the workplace.
